Hartford Marion Harding, 84, of Medina, Ohio, passed away on October 1, 2023. He was born on July 14, 1939, in Navarre, Ohio, to the late Ruth (Wood) and Hartford M. Harding Sr. Hartford was a sincere, intelligent, and thoughtful individual who was deeply family-oriented.
Hartford graduated from the University of Michigan, and had a successful career as an executive for Goodyear Tire and Rubber company, where he dedicated 35 years of his life. He was known for his hard work and dedication to his profession. He retired to Bluffton, South Carolina where he and his wife enjoyed warmer winters.
In his free time, Hartford enjoyed boating, fishing, golf, and spending quality time with his family. These hobbies brought him great joy and allowed him to create lasting memories with his family and friends at Duncan Bay Boat Club.
Hartford is survived by his beloved wife, Sheryl (White) Harding; his daughter, Heather (Harding) Urbanic; his daughter, Heidi (Harding) Burkey, and son-in-law, Jeff Burkey; his grandchildren; James and Megan Urbanic, and Ethan and Emily Burkey; his brother and sister-in-law, Robert and Tomilee Harding; and his nieces and nephews, Robert Harding, Scott and Danielle Harding, Rachelle Harding, and Regina Harding. He was preceded in death by his parents and his brother, Thad Harding.
A Celebration of Life will be held at Duncan Bay Boat Club in Cheboygan, Michigan, during the summer of 2024. This gathering will give family and friends the opportunity to honor and remember Hartford’s life.
In lieu of flowers, contributions can be made to the American Red Cross, or St. Jude Children’s Hospital, two organizations that were close to Hartford’s heart.
The Hilliard-Rospert funeral home in Wadsworth, Ohio, is assisting the family with the arrangements during this difficult time.
